Description
The CitiBike program is Miami's bike sharing and rental system. The CitiBike program is intended to provide locals and visitors with an additional transportation option for getting around the city. Bike sharing is fun, efficient and convenient.
The solar-powered bike sharing system consists of a fleet of specially designed, sturdy, very durable bikes that are locked into a network of docking stations sited at regular intervals around a city.
With a thousand bikes at a hundred stations and more on the way downtown, bikes are available to use 24 hours a day, 365 days a year.

Unusable
95% of screens in this app fail on server errors after about a 15-second timeout. I paid for a monthly subscription I can’t even use because requests to release bikes consistently fail on server errors. Sometimes the network randomly succeed- again about 5% of the time- and by the time you can release a bike, you’ll have been standing there waiting for flaky network requests along the way for at least 5-10 minutes.
In the rare moments when the app physically works, the UI is slow and confusing. The user and bike station pins look nearly identical, making it visually impossible to tell which station is closest to you.
Apple, PLEASE yank this thing!!

Older review
As a long-term Miami Beach resident, I love the DecoBike system. The Deco Bikes app is a great complement, particularly after updating to v1.1.
Its geolocation engine is now fixed so it finds me and gives me the nearest bike stations and how many bikes are available.
The method of locating a station, by opening a Google Map page, and adding it as a favorite is a bit convoluted but now works.
The "How to use DecoBike" section could have more substance and a link to the full DecoBike website is now at the Info/About DecoBike section. The embedded DecoBike video it referred to in version 1.0 is now viewed as well via a link within the Info/About DecoBike section.
All in all, a major improvement over first version.
